Latest Patents

One of Ohiro's latest patents is the "Process for making a disposable diaper." This innovative approach involves continuously feeding a first web in its longitudinal direction while introducing tape fastener members folded in Z-shape or inverted Z-shape. These members are carefully bonded to the first web using self-adhesives, allowing for a more efficient production process. The simultaneous cutting of the first web and tape fasteners along specific lines further enhances the manufacturing speed.

Another notable patent is the "Article turning-round apparatus," designed to improve the handling of articles in a production line. This apparatus includes a rotary table that rotates via a first shaft, with load-carrying tables mounted on its peripheral zone. This configuration allows articles to be efficiently conveyed between stations while being turned approximately 90 degrees, either counterclockwise or clockwise, facilitating smooth operations in packaging and distribution.
